I installed a few days ago my flux cp and now I have the problem, when somebody registers himself the e-mail to confirm the account won't be send.

My problem isn't really that they don't confirm it, but when they forgot their password the e-mail to reset the password won't be send either.

The mail from our server is linked to our domain mail, not from gmail by example. The mail server is on the same server with the flux cp.

That's a misconfiguration in your webhost, or you haven't installed sendmail/postfix/etc in order to use the default php mail.

Alternatively you can configure SMTP sending on flux application.php file.

SMTP is recommended. As Daegaladh mentioned this is generally a misconfiguration by your host, more often than not though it's due to a missing SPF DNS record so your users' mailboxes are rejecting the mail as it can't be recognised as coming from an authenticated source.
